Invesco Multi-Factor Core Plus fixed Income ETF (IMFP) Research
The Invesco Multi-Factor Core Plus fixed Income ETF endeavors to replicate the financial performance of the Invesco Multi-Factor Core Plus Index (referred to as its benchmark), before factoring in its own expenses and fees. The fund generally commits a minimum of 80% of its total portfolio value to the specific securities that comprise this underlying index. This benchmark is strategically designed to provide investors with multi-factor exposure within the realm of fixed income instruments. It should also be noted that the fund operates on a non-diversified basis.
